In no particular order, here are the the things I would do in my business if I were starting over from zero: no followers, no business, no clue what I was doing.

–Intentional social media and in person networking

–An hour a day minimum to work on/in my business

–Find an accountability partner to check in with, maybe cowork with once a week

–Do free trainings/value in groups, on my page, everywhere

–Make a collab list of 20 people and interact with them weekly to build repertoire.

–Join a Mastermind and hire a coach for occasional 1-1 strategy calls

–Promote ONE thing

–Not over complicate things

–Podcast and personal development daily

–Prioritize sleep, movement and nutrition
